The November 2025 labour law shift refers to the expected implementation of revised wage-related provisions under India’s labour law reforms. These changes standardize how “wages” are calculated and limit the extent to which allowances can be used to reduce statutory contributions.

The short answer is: yes, in many cases, take-home salary may reduce slightly, at least in the short term.
Here’s why:
Under the new framework, basic pay must form a larger portion of total salary. Since contributions like provident fund are calculated on basic pay, deductions increase.

Not necessarily. While monthly take-home pay may reduce, long-term benefits improve.
Employees can expect:
In other words, you may take home less today, but you build more financial security for the future.
